Biography

Beatriz P. Nobre, PhD in chemical Engineering, (Instituto Superior Técnico, Universidade de Lisboa, Portugal). Post-Doc at Bioenergy Unit of LNEG (Lisbon, Portugal) 2008-2014. Post-Doct at CQE (IST, Lisbon Portugal), IBB (IST, Universidade de Lisboa) and UCIBIO (NOVA School of Science and Technology) 2015-2018. Auxiliary Researcher at CQE (IST, Universidade de Lisboa), from 2018. Her research interest concerned the use of green solvents, i.e. supercritical fluids, pressurized liquids in chemical engineering processes: extraction and fractionation processes of bioactive compounds from non-edible biomass and industrial waste residues; particle engineering for the production of micro and nanoparticles of bioactives, APIs, catalysts and encapsulates; catalytic heterogeneous reactions using green routes.
